Quote from justinmega1 :
Can I use this as a NAS for our entire household? Can it be accessed remotely?

Edit: nvm it doesn't even have an Ethernet port. Will take any recommendations you guys have!
Some modem/routers have a USB port that can be configured as a shared drive (usually pretty slow). Or if you have an old tower/computer you can setup unRAID, JBOD, or similar. You can also map a network drive to share on your computer using an internal or external drive. Qnap and Synology also make a decent NAS.

Quote from doctorttt :
Is the drive CMR or SMR?
Pretty sure any WD drive over 6Tb is CMR. Easystores are usually Red or Whites when shucked.
